A few days ago, Honda unveiled an exciting lineup of seven new and three updated models for the Indian market, all set to launch within the current financial year. Although the Japanese automaker didn’t share the specific launch date, a Reddit post circulating online offers insights into when these products might arrive and what they could cost.
- According to the Reddit post, the Honda ADV160 maxi-styled scooter, along with the Rebel 300, XR 300 L and XR 300 Rally, are likely to be launched in the third quarter of FY 2026–27 (between October and December 2026).
- The post also suggests that the ADV160 is expected to be priced at around Rs 1.7 lakh (ex-showroom), while the Rebel 300 could cost approximately Rs 2 lakh.
- For adventure enthusiasts, the Honda XR 300L and XR 300 Rally are expected to be priced at around Rs 1.8 lakh (ex-showroom).
- Speaking of the Rebel 500, it is likely to be launched in the fourth quarter of FY2026-27 (between January and March 2027), with prices likely to be 25 per cent less than the earlier CBU model, which was priced at Rs 5.5 lakh (ex-showroom).

Here’s a quick review of these upcoming bikes and scooters: –
- Honda ADV10: The all-new Honda ADV160 is an adventure-styled maxi scooter, powered by a 157cc, water-cooled engine. It will take on the likes of the Yamaha Aerox 155 (Rs 1.44 lakh).
- Rebel 500: It is a mid-size cruiser, powered by a 471 cc liquid-cooled twin-cylinder engine and will also be offered in Standard and E-Clutch variants.
- Rebel 300: Honda will also be offering the Rebel motorcycle with a smaller 286cc, liquid-cooled engine (30PS and 27.5Nm), which is expected to be priced more competitively due to its smaller displacement engine.
- XR 300L: It has been developed for riders who want to tackle off-road conditions while retaining everyday usability. Powered by a 293.5 cc air-cooled engine with an oil cooler, the XR 300L focuses on lightness, easy handling, and confidence across both on-road and off-road use. With long-travel suspension, it is aimed at adventure seekers who want a motorcycle for weekend trail riding, nearby off-road locations, and weekday city use.
- XR 300 Rally: Builds on the rally platform, the new XR 300 Rally has a stronger focus on long-distance trail touring and mixed-terrain travel. Inspired by Honda’s rally heritage, the XR 300 Rally is positioned as a Versatile Terrain Conqueror, designed for riders who want to explore new destinations across challenging on-road and off-road conditions. It combines rally-inspired styling, comfort-oriented equipment, and performance suited for weekend touring and trail exploration.
Alongside the above-mentioned models, Honda will also introduce the QC3 electric scooter, CB500 cruiser, and updated versions of the CB350 model range.
